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Clapham (North Yorkshire) to Effingham Junction start from as little as £49.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Clapham (North Yorkshire) to Effingham Junction start from £84.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Clapham (North Yorkshire) to Effingham Junction are available for £187.20 one way

Everything you need to know about Clapham (North Yorkshire) Station

Discovering Clapham (North Yorkshire) Train Station

Set in the picturesque landscape of North Yorkshire, Clapham (North Yorkshire) train station is your gateway to some of England's most charming rural vistas. An unassuming yet vital stop on the local rail network, this station welcomes adventurers and commuters alike, offering paths to many popular destinations. Despite its modest size, Clapham (North Yorkshire) boasts several essential features and connections to ensure a smooth and enjoyable journey.

Station Facilities and Access

The facilities at Clapham (North Yorkshire) are straightforward, reflecting its rural character. There is no ticket office or ticket machine available, so travelers are advised to purchase tickets in advance or rely on alternative purchase methods when planning their journeys. An induction loop is present for enhanced accessibility for those with hearing impairments. Although the station is categorized as having partial step-free access (Category B), travelers should note that there is no wheelchair access to the Lancaster-bound platform due to a footbridge. Nevertheless, the Leeds-bound platform is easily reachable via level access.

While waiting areas and 1st Class Lounges are absent, the station provides a car park operated by Northern with 12 spaces. It remains accessible 24 hours a day throughout the week, free of charge. Cyclists are supported with 10 sheltered bicycle storage spaces on Platform 1, complete with CCTV security.

Onward Travel and Connections

To complement your rail journey, Clapham offers a limited range of onward travel options. Taxis can be arranged, providing easy links to your next destination through services such as Cab4You. An absence of nearby bus services necessitates consultation with Busline for the best connections—indicating a station more suited to travelers using personal or hired transportation. For those who might need it, rail replacement services can be accessed from the station car park with suitable transport.

Everything you need to know about Effingham Junction Station

Welcome to Effingham Junction Train Station

Effingham Junction, nestled in the picturesque Surrey countryside, is a charming stop that serves as a gateway to both the bustling city of London and the serene locales of Southern England. Whether you're a daily commuter, a day-tripper heading into the city, or a leisure traveler aiming to explore Surrey’s scenic beauty, Effingham Junction is a convenient starting point for many exciting journeys.

Station Facilities at Effingham Junction

Effingham Junction off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th and comfortable visit. Tickets can be purchased and collected at the station. The ticket office operates from 06:30 to 12:00 Monday to Friday and 09:00 to 13:00 on Saturdays. Ticket machines are accessible and cater to passengers with different needs, including those eligible for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Additionally, an induction loop is available to assist those with hearing difficulties.

While there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, visitors will find seating areas and accessible toilets at their disposal. Parking is ample, with 160 spaces, including three accessible spots. CCTV is installed for added security. Cyclists can benefit from 42 sheltered cycle racks monitored by CCTV.

Onward Travel Connections

Effingham Junction provides various onward travel connections. For those seeking alternatives during service disruptions, a rail replacement service operates from the station car park off Howard Road. Bus services offer additional travel flexibility, and detailed onward journey planning is available in printable formats via the National Rail website. Although no taxi rank or car hire services are directly linked from the station, the surrounding region provides several options for those requiring private hire services or self-driving rental vehicles.
